Find inmate data from the Michigan Department of Corrections
The MDC oversees prisons and the probation and parole populations within Michigan. It is responsible for 31 prison facilities and looks over some 41,000 prisoners. The MDC has roughly 14,000 employees as of the 2017 count. The offender information Tracking System or the OTIS will have information about prisoners, probationers, parolees who are under supervision or who have been discharged with three years of their supervision discharge data. Once you do then read the next page and agree to the terms to get started with a search for Michigan inmates. The next page will be the search parameter box. You can search inmates first and last name or an MDOC number if you have one. You can also
Once you perform a search you will see the results page. it will have the offender number, full name, DOB, sex, race, MCL number, location of offender, status, parole date, sentence length, and date paroled if any.
Click on the “offender Number to gain more information about that inmate.
